About Kingston University London
Kingston University London is a public university located in Kingston and offers a wide range of undergraduate, postgraduate, and professional programs across disciplines like business, engineering, computer science, arts, design, health, and social sciences. It has a diverse student body and is equipped with modern facilities. It is known for balancing academic rigor with practical, hands-on learning experiences, preparing students for global careers.
Kingston University London was established in 1992 when it gained university status, since then, it has grown in size and reputation, focusing on providing high-quality education, fostering research, and developing strong connections with industries. It has become a key educational institution in the London area, attracting students from around the world.

Location
Kingston University London is located in Kingston upon Thames, a historic town in southwest London, approximately 12 miles (20 km) from central London. However, there are multiple other campuses including- Penrhyn Road Campus, Kingston Hill Campus, Canbury Park Road Campus, Seething Wells Campus.

Entry Requirements
- Academic Qualifications: High school diploma equivalent with strong academic performance and understanding with required subjects and grades (Undergraduate)
- Bachelorās Degree (Postgraduate)
- English Proficiency: Met through (IELTS- minimum score of 6.0, TOEFL-minimum score of 55 (iBT), Duolingo English Test-minimum score of 85) or equivalent exams.
- Work Experience (if applicable): For some MBA or Masterās in Business programs, professional work experience (often 2-3 years) may be required

Cost of Study
The cost of study at Kingston University London includes tuition fees and living expenses. Understanding these costs is crucial for planning your educational journey.
Tuition fees for international students at Kingston University London vary depending on the course and level of study; which can range from approximately GBP 16,200 to GBP 18,400 per year.
Accommodation is one of the major expenses for students. Kingston University London offers various options, from on-campus housing to private rentals. Here is a brief overview:
- On-Campus Housing: The university provides halls of residence, which include single or shared rooms. Prices range from Ā£150 to Ā£250 per week, depending on the type and location of the accommodation.
- Private Rentals: The cost of renting a private apartment or house can vary widely. A one-bedroom apartment in Kingston might cost between Ā£900 and Ā£1,300 per month.
- Shared Housing: Sharing a house with other students can be more economical. Shared accommodations typically range from Ā£400 to Ā£700 per month per person.

Daily Living Costs
Daily living costs include food, transportation, and leisure activities. Hereās a breakdown of what you might expect to spend:
- Food: Grocery for a month can cost between Ā£150 and Ā£300. Eating out will add to this cost, averaging Ā£10 – Ā£15.
- Transportation: A monthly public travel pass can cost around Ā£100 – Ā£150.
- Leisure Activities: Expect to spend about Ā£50 – Ā£100 per month on personal expenses.

Yes, international students at Kingston University London are generally allowed to work while studying, subject to certain restrictions based on their visa conditions. Part-time work is typically restricted to a maximum of 20 hours per week during term time for degree-level courses.
